Vorarlberger Nachrichten (simply VN) is a German language regional newspaper published in Bregenz, Austria. It is one of the leading regional publications in the country. VN was first published on 16 November 1945 during the occupation of Austria by the US and French forces following World War II. The paper has its headquarters in Bregenz and serves for Vorarlberg. The Vorarlberg Media, which is also the owner of NEUE, owns the paper. It is published by the Russmedia Verlag which also publishes NEUE. Both companies are headed by Eugene A. Russ. Christian Ortner served as the editor-in-chief of VN.
